Apollo 11 Spacesuit Replica

Step into the boots of Neil Armstrong and Buzz Aldrin — literally — as you donn this museum-quality replica of their iconic spacesuit, the same they wore to make mankind's first small steps and giant leaps across the Moon's Tranquility Base!

The design and molds for this spacesuit replica were taken from an authentic NASA Apollo-era A7L garments. They are built to our exact specifications with the highest attention paid to every detail.

Made from a heavy weight Nylon Cordura, this suit was built for wear and tear. It can be worn or placed on display. Truly fantastic for the collector or museum. Features:

* Apollo 11 Space Suit Aluminum Cuffs
* Aluminuml Neck Ring
* Aluminum Hose Fittings
* Nylon Cordura Fabric

Apollo 11 Helmet
* Two (2) Side Sun Shields
* Outer Gold Sun Visor
* Aluminum Neck Ring

Snoopy Cap
* Stretchable Material
* Foam Ear Covers
* Elastic Chin Strap

Front / Back Pack
* Snapping Aluminum Hose Couplings
* Air Hoses
* Metal Front Pack (attaches to suit)

Space Gloves
* Heavy Canvas Material
* Rubber Finger Tips

Space Boots
* Fit Over Your Shoes
* Canvas and Rubber
* Straps
